Transaction 352e6199c6536705a189761fa7d38832da295f7650b82fcf567cf1cbb29e2ae1

1 Input
2 Outputs
  • 352e6199c6536705a189761fa7d38832da295f7650b82fcf567cf1cbb29e2ae1:0
  • value  1490960
    address  16Hr13FJkqGzV34V2t8sczxN5QW4YozMQo
  • 352e6199c6536705a189761fa7d38832da295f7650b82fcf567cf1cbb29e2ae1:1
  • value  12344628
    address  3GYQjuTNty4cXxiSaoZjWA8oSphkyZs85h